I've been playing the GBA Zoids game. Apparently, it's the second GBA Zoids game. Huh. It's... at least somewhat addictive, which is a good thing. At the start, it was simple -- you had one Zoid, maybe two when a person was with you for story reasons, and the enemies you were up against were really easy. Still, they were enough of a speedbump that you could feel the effect when you upped various stats and tried out new weapons.

You fought in a few arenas, got Bit as a partner, went to a few cities, and then -- a crazy old man gives you a new zoid, better in some fundamental ways than the one you've been upgrading all along, but weaker in others until you find the money to upgrade it, and an organoid with strange powers you don't understand. And Bit leaves you.

Then you fight in *one* battle, and suddenly get saddled with three new pilots and four new zoids, with a confusing (and as it turns out, mostly useless) combination power that makes you ditch your new new Zoid (which you just spent the dregs of your money upgrading) for the unoccupied Zoid to test it out.

But before you can actually fight using it, you get warped to another world without any good stores (the stores there sell only expensive and heavy equipment that you could never use) and WHAM, three MORE new pilots and four MORE new Zoids with their own combination (that I never bothered trying out). AND Van joins you, with his blade liger.

So there I was, with ten Zoids that I had no feel for and had basically never fought with, but were way more powerful than the old familiar Zoids, and a gaggle of pilots that meant nothing to me, and I wanted to strangle someone. Since the fights started getting *hard* about then.

By now, though, I've got this entourage about sorted out, and Van left so I don't have to fill a space with a guest character, and I'm getting some crucial upgrades and equipment in, and even building a few new zoids to replace the weaker 'blox' zoids. So things are looking up.
